【问题标题】:Error in Azure DevOps website deployment on IIS在 IIS 上部署 Azure DevOps 网站时出错
【发布时间】:2024-01-10 20:06:01
【问题描述】:

我有一个基于 Azure DevOps 构建的 dotnet 应用程序(与 2017 相比)。我正在尝试将生成的工件部署到本地 IIS 上。但是在完成所有过程后,我收到以下错误。

谁能帮忙解决一下。

【问题讨论】:

  • 您提到“部署本地”。这意味着什么?您是否有一个设置了构建代理的 VM,并且您想在该 VM 上进行部署?
  • @Salman 代理在哪里运行?
  • @RobBos 问题已更新。
  • @ZairHenrique 请检查更新
  • 你的服务器操作系统是什么?

标签: .net visual-studio iis azure-devops azure-pipelines-release-pipeline


【解决方案1】:

IIS Web App 管理器只能在 Windows Server 机器上运行,因为它会尝试使用仅在 WinServer 上可用的“servermanager”。

当您在本地计算机(即 Windows 桌面系统)上运行此代理时,您应该使用其他方式在发布管道上进行部署(powershell 脚本/cmd)。

【讨论】:

    最近更新 更多